Valdis Story: Abyssal City Gets New Bosses, Playable Characters, More In Big Update

Recommended Videos

 

Valdis Story: Abyssal City has had a major update recently that fixes a ton of smaller issues in the game as well as adds plenty of new content to try out.

 

Focusing on the additions, Vladyn and Gilda are now playable once you’ve completed the game on any difficulty, you can get a new crew member called Daemahn, there are four new bosses to beat, and there are also two new zones to conquer (Tainted Laboratory and Hall of the Fallen). Plus, you can acquire a new accessory called the Treasure Hunter’s Gimcrack, attain a new Elixir item from one of the new vendors (of which there are two), earn an upgrade for the Mana Key Stone, and buy hats from the new millinery.

 

Lastly, there are new treasure chests to find and new achievements to earn.

As to the changes, there are far too many to outline briefly, but they range from reduced stun duration but increased stun damage taken, to the Warp Blade summoning a void magic warp blade to strike your target for critical hits, and updated multiple enemy variants. If you’re unfamiliar with Valdis Story: Abyssal City, think of it as an action-platformer with a focus on exploration and fights that combine swordsmanship, martial arts, and sorcery. It has been compared to Castlevania in the past as it contains similar elements, and its story follows what’s left of humanity as two warring goddesses who gradually turn them into angels or demons to fight on their side.
